Todos vocês já sabem como exclua arquivos e diretórios no Linux, tanto das ferramentas disponíveis no ambiente de área de trabalho quanto aquelas que nos são fornecidas no shell (como o comando que todos saberão, rm). Mas neste mini tutorial vamos nos concentrar em como apagar dados grandes, aqueles que ocupam vários GB em nosso disco rígido e que pode ser interessante excluí-los para recuperar algum espaço em nossa unidade de armazenamento.
Quando excluímos dados com um conteúdo inferior, isso geralmente não é muito problemático, pois não significa um grande fardo no sistema planejamento de I / O e da unidade de armazenamento em questão, bem como um grande consumo de RAM, principalmente ao usar determinadas ferramentas. Mas se forem arquivos muito pesados, como algum vídeo de alta duração e em HD em determinados formatos, ou bases de dados, diretórios com muito conteúdo multimídia, etc., o problema cresce no aspecto temporal, pois demora pouco mais para realizar o processo quando se trata de grandes espaços.
Existem ferramentas como fragmentação e remoção segura Para o apagamento seguro de dados, mas não para sobrecarregar muito o sistema ao apagar esses dados monstruosos, estamos interessados no nosso comando de uma vida, rm e também em combinação com outro comando chamado ionice. Se você não tiver em sua distro, instale-o ...
Com certeza você lembra de outro velho conhecido, legal, bem, sim, ionice é o bom da entrada e saída, permitindo atribuir prioridade a coisas diferentes, não apenas para excluir dados, mas também para acelerar outras tarefas, como transferências (ripar), mover dados, etc. Por exemplo, o que o modo 3 faria é executar a tarefa de exclusão quando o sistema estiver livre e não estivermos executando outras tarefas prioritárias. Por exemplo:
sudo ionice -c 3 rm /nombre/fichero/o/directorio/a/borrar
Cada número age de maneira diferente para ele Agendador de I / O ou agendador. Um 0 não é nada, 1 para tempo real, 2 para baixa prioridade e 3 para modo IDLE. Se não quisermos atrasar muito a tarefa, podemos dar-lhe um 2 e será feito de uma forma um pouco mais rápida do que no modo inativo, mas não desacelera tanto como se faz em tempo real ...